Transaction 141aaaaa526becae316d30f110f538465d5c7074a99bc19f881d4054413482d5

1 Input
2 Outputs
  • 141aaaaa526becae316d30f110f538465d5c7074a99bc19f881d4054413482d5:0
  • value  488652
    address  19PYRr31PhzquhAJRuSPXv8xCVQJVMBvDR
  • 141aaaaa526becae316d30f110f538465d5c7074a99bc19f881d4054413482d5:1
  • value  39025343
    address  3MPpNYUn8uSoU23dgDRXajdYEjx7Txq178